‘Alles op Vélo’ between Mamer and Mersch

For the first time, the municipalities of Mamer, Kopstal and Mersch launched the ‘Alles op Vélo’ event on the route between Mamer and Mersch, with stops in Kopstal and Schoenfels.

Throughout the day, the CR101 was closed to motorized traffic. Mostly families, but also many senior citizens, were out on their bikes, on foot or on rollerblades, enjoying the varied program of food and entertainment on offer at the various stops.

In Mamer, where the start and finish were in front of the water treatment plant, participants were welcomed by members of the Mobility, Sport and Environment Commissions to register for the rally.

At the ‘Vëlosatelier’ stand, it was possible to have minor repairs carried out on bikes. Catering was provided by local clubs BBC Mambra, FC Mamer 32, VC Mamer and Trispeed.

Along the way, a historic bicycle belonging to Nicolas Frantz attracted the Blickes.
The granddaughter of the two-time Tour de France winner (1927 and 1928), who was on the handlebars, even woreoriginal shoes from the era, as today’s shoes are not compatible with historic pedals.
